Four feeding frequencies of one (T1), two (T2), three (T3) and four (T4) times a day were evaluated as treatments on Mystus gulio in triplicate net cages (2×1×1 m) for a period of 60 days. Hatchery produced twelve-day old M. gulio fry (0.02 g/ 12 mm) stocked at 300 number/ net cage were fed with a CIBA formulated diet (Crude protein 30%) at 15-5% of the biomass daily.
